Op Cyber Hawk: Delhi Police bust cyber crime syndicate
During the investigation, it was revealed that the syndicate used WhatsApp, Telegram, and SMS forwarder APKs to control mule accounts and siphon funds to China-based operators. They converted proceeds to USDT cryptocurrency via platforms like KuCoin and Binance. ₹15 crore suspicious transactions were identified and victims are being notified.

MP Cabinet approves implementation of SpaceTech Policy–2026
The policy will promote innovation in satellite manufacturing, geospatial analysis, and downstream applications. Over the next five years, the policy is expected to attract Rs 1,000 crore investment and generate approximately 8,000 jobs, with an estimated financial implication of Rs 628 crore.
